La Barra de Chocolate – Buenos Aires Beat Lyrics

Artist: La Barra de Chocolate
Song: Buenos Aires Beat

Buenos Aires se adormece
Corrientes es un billar
Los bares casi desnudos
Duermen su soledad

Y el verde anaranjada ceba a Purús y Neón
Miguelito está en la plaza
Enseguida va a fumar
Su guitarra lo acompaña

Y la canción va a comenzar
El diarero está gritando
Las noticias que hacen mal
Los colores toman forma

Se lo dan a la ciudad
Esta sangre está despertando
Y yo quiero fornicar
Buenos Aires se adormece

Tras un largo despertar
Edificios que se mueven
Allá lejos, más allá
Y el diarero está gritando

Las noticias que hacen mal
Los colores toman forma
Se lo dan a la ciudad
Esta sangre está despertando

Y yo quiero fornicar
